Abstract
An embedded hardware-software Electrocardiogram platform had been conceived, were the design of the Einthoven's lead DI was been described. The system is based on the use of dry electrodes which had been set on three points of the body skin, the sensed signal fed an analog signal pre-processor to enhance its level and improve its noise immunity. The analog processor includes a typical filtering in two bands: the first band B1 is from 0.05 to 40Hz and the second B2 is from 0.05 to 150Hz. Since the analog signal approaches both the desired level and signal to noise ratio, a digital circuit based on microcontroller (AN2131QC) transforms the signal across a normalized USB bus transfer. In any cases, the embedded system could communicate in real time directly to a computer with USB port. Several data acquisition and recording file have been accomplished. Then, some processing tools have been implemented under MATLAB software as the representation of the ECG signals and its spectrum analysis for furthers offline processing.
